1 Introduction The APC Uninterruptible Power Supply (UPS) is designed to prevent blackouts, brownouts, sags, and surges from reaching your equipment. 2 2: S TART UP Connect the Battery Connect black wire to battery. (Red wire is already connected.) Note: Small sparks at the point of battery connection are normal.
